Cardiovascular Disease (CVD)
Cardiovascular disease comprises diseases of the heart and blood vessels including coronary heart disease (heart attack and angina), stroke (also called cerebrovascular disease), heart failure and peripheral vascular disease.
Cardiovascular disease is Australia’s largest health problem, accounting for over 50,000 deaths in 2002 and affecting 3.67 million Australians in 2001.
